Comment: I've got this old laptop on which I would like to upgrade the BIOS. When I recieved the laptop (won off ebay) the BIOS was a 1998 version. I tried to update it but it wouldn't let me, as the laptop didn't have a battery installed. I looked on the net and found a way around this and updated it anyway. I used the BIOS off this page: http://www-307.ibm.com/pc/support/s... which is clearly dated Ocotber 2001. The BIOS did update successfully (and did in fact fix an issue I was hoping it would). However, for some reason the BIOS date is now 1999! Am I missing something? Thanks for any advice. Alex

Reply: (edit)It is possible the bios version you now have was first written in 1999, and re-published in 2001. The fact that it has fixed whatever issue you had is the important thing. congratulations.
